Yes, you can add a spoon of butter to your coffee for a rich and creamy coffee experience, or heavy cream for a luxuriously creamy, smooth drink. If your diet doesn't include dairy, you can use some coconut oil as a dairy alternative. Whichever way you choose, try blending the ingredients together for a few seconds before you drink it, to get a smooth, creamy coffee consistency. At that time, the Brazilian Coffee Institute asked Nestlé to prepare a flavorful and soluble coffee. In 1937, Max Morgenthaler, who worked at Nestlé, revealed a new way to prepare soluble coffee with the help of soluble carbohydrates and dried coffee extract.
